Removing Old Touches
If you require to replace old taps with new ones as a part of your setup, after that the first thing you should do is disconnect the supply of water. After doing so, switch on the faucets to drain pipes any kind of water continuing to be in the system. The procedure of getting rid of the existing faucets can be fairly bothersome as a result of the limited accessibility that is often the case.
Make use of a container wrench (crowsfoot spanner) or a faucet tool to undo the nut that attaches the supply pipelines to the taps. Have a cloth all set for the continuing to be water that will come from the pipelines. When the supply pipes have actually been eliminated, use the very same tool to loosen up the nut that holds the taps onto the bath/basin. You will need to stop the single taps from transforming during this process. Once the taps have actually been gotten rid of, the holes in the bath/basin will need to be cleansed of any type of old sealing substance.
Before going on to fit the new faucets, compare the pipeline connections on the old faucets to the new taps. If the old faucets are longer than the new faucets, after that a shank adapter is required for the brand-new faucets to fit.
Fitting New Touches
If the tails of the brand-new taps are plastic, then you will certainly require a plastic connector to avoid damages to the thread. One end of the port fits on the plastic tail of the faucet and also the other end offers a link to the current supply pipelines.
If you require to fit a monobloc, then you will require minimizing couplers, which attaches the 10mm pipeline of the monobloc to the standard 15mm supply pipe.
Next, position the tap in the mounting hole in the bath/basin guaranteeing that the washers are in place in between the faucet and also the sink. Safeguard the faucet in place with the producer offered backnut. Once the faucet is securely in place, the supply pipelines can be connected to the tails of the faucets. The taps can either be connected by using corrugated copper piping or with typical tap adapters. The previous type should be attached to the tap ends initially, tightening just by hand. The supply pipes can later on be connected to the various other end. Tighten both ends with a spanner after both ends have actually been linked.
Installing the Tub
Using the two wood boards under its feet, place the tub in the required setting. The wood boards are useful in equally spreading the weight of the tub over the location of the boards as opposed to focusing all the weight onto four little factors.
The following goal is to guarantee that the tub is leveled all round. This can be attained by checking the spirit level and changing the feet on the tub up until the level reviews degree.
To mount faucets, fit all-time low of the outermost versatile faucet port to the proper supply pipeline by making a compression join; then do the same for the other faucet.
Activate the water and also examine all joints as well as new pipework for leaks and also tighten them if needed. Fill up the bathtub as well as additionally check the overflow electrical outlet and the typical outlet for leakages.
Ultimately, take care of the bathroom paneling as explained in the producer's user's manual. Tiling as well as sealing around the tub should wait up until the bathtub has actually been used a minimum of once as this will resolve it into its final placement.
Getting ready for the Installment
Firstly, the sustaining structure supplied with the bath needs to be fitted (if required) according to the producer's directions. Next off, fit the faucets or mixer to the bathtub. When fitting the tap block, it is very important to see to it that if the faucet comes with a plastic washer, it is fitted between the bath and the taps. On a plastic bath, it is also sensible to fit a supporting plate under the faucets device to stop pressure on the bath tub.
Fit the versatile tap connectors to the bottom of the two faucets making use of 2 nuts as well as olives (often supplied with the tub). Fit the plug-hole electrical outlet by smearing mastic filler round the sink electrical outlet hole, and afterwards pass the electrical outlet with the hole in the bath. Make use of the nut supplied by the manufacturer to fit the plug-hole. Check out the plug-hole outlet for an inlet on the side for the overflow pipeline.
Next, fit the end of the versatile overflow pipe to the overflow electrical outlet. Afterwards, screw the pipeline to the overflow face which must be fitted inside the bath. Ensure you make use of all of the supplied washers.
Attach the trap to the bottom of the waste outlet on the bathtub by winding the string of the waste electrical outlet with silicone mastic or PTFE tape, and also screw on the catch to the electrical outlet. Link the bottom of the overflow tube in a similar manner.The bathroom need to currently prepare to be fitted in its final placement.
Tiling Around the Tub
In the area where the bath fulfills the ceramic tile, it is required to secure the accompanies a silicone rubber caulking. This is very important as the fitting can relocate enough to fracture a stiff seal, causing the water to pass through the wall in between the bath as well as the tiling, leading to issues with dampness as well as feasible leaks to the ceiling listed below.
You can pick from a variety of coloured sealers to assimilate your fixtures and installations. They are marketed in tubes and cartridges, and are capable of securing voids approximately a width of 3mm (1/8 inch). If you have a larger space to fill up, you can load it with spins of drenched paper or soft rope. Bear in mind to constantly load the bath tub with water prior to securing, to permit the activity experienced when the bathtub remains in use. The sealer can split rather early if you do not take into account this activity prior to sealing.
Additionally, ceramic coving or quadrant floor tiles can be used to edge the bathroom or shower tray. Plastic strips of coving, which are easy to use and also cut to size, are additionally conveniently available on the market. It is a good idea to fit the floor tiles making use of waterproof or waterproof adhesive and grout.

Install Piping Before Tub
You will be using your existing drain and waste vent system, but pipes required include the hot and cold water supply lines and a pipe leading to a shower head. A mixing valve and shower head are also needed. Air chambers may be required.
Position the Tub
Lower the tub into place so that the continuous flange fits against the wall studs and rests on 1’x4' or 2’x4' supports. Anchor the tub to the enclosure with nails or screws inserted through the flanges into the studs.
NOTE: Remember, bathtubs and shower stalls may require support framing. A bathtub filled with water is extremely heavy, so check building codes and framing support before installing the tub.
Assemble Drain Connections
Assemble the bathtub drain connections by connecting the tub overflow with the tub drain above the trap, not beyond it. The trap will have a compression fitting that screws over the arm of the overflow assembly.
Place a Pipe For the Shower Head
First, locate a brass female threaded winged fitting and attach it to a framing support via a screw or a nail. Then run a pipe up the wall for the shower head. Sweat or solder the other side of the brass fitting to the top of the pipe.
Attaching Hot and Cold Water Lines
Attach your water lines for both hot and cold by sweating these directly into the hot and cold ports of the mixing valve. The mixing valve will be how water enters the tub’s system, not by the pipes themselves.
Install the Spout
Extend a piece of 1/2 inch pipe, or whichever length is specified in the manufacturer’s instructions, for the tub spout. Sweat on a male threaded fitting at the end of the pipe or use a brass nipple of the proper length and a 1/2 inch cap.
NOTE: At this point you should have your rough-in plumbing work inspected before proceeding further.
Check For Leaks
Restore the water pressure and check the drain connection and the supply pipes for any sign of leaking.
estore the Bathroom Wall
Replace the wall with moisture-resistant drywall as a base for your wall covering. Seal the joints between the wall and your new tub with silicone caulk as protection against water seepage.
